Total damage from first trip (only 3 hours worth o wheeling)

Finished off driver u joint - was tight, now loose and pops/clicks
Bent LCA skid
Scratches/gouges in, LCAs X member, sliders, both pigs, and a few on rear tubes.
Popped gas tank.

Good weekend. To-do list before next "trip"

U joints in all shafts
Straighten bent crap and re-plate
Pull both bumpers, clean, and bedline
Fuel cell, or new tank and relocate.

Tore the valve cover off, intake and exhaust manifolds.

Doing the 99+ intake swap with 99+ injectors need to get a mechanical gauge make sure I'm pushing 49psi at the rail.

Decided upon this mod as I had to remove the intake to replace exhaust manifold.

Now debating if I want to pull the head and port&polish it while I already have it apart...also good amount of carbon build up in there.

Read a lot about people seeing no gain, and sometimes loss with the 99+ intake.

I think il see some gains, already have after market exhaust, plan on doing new intake with install, proper fuel pressure, and if I port and polish.
